Why Do We Yawn in the First Place?

Understanding the Context

Yawning is a natural human response, deeply rooted in our biology. While the exact cause remains a subject of ongoing research, scientists agree that yawns serve several purposes: regulating brain temperature, synchronizing group behavior, and sharpening attention. Normally, a yawn starts with a deep inhalation followed by a broad opening of the mouth—and that’s when the real magic can begin.
